Season 4 Overview

Season 4 brought significant changes to the system mechanics — Roman Cancel recovery was adjusted, and several characters received sweeping buffs that reshuffled the tier list. Here's where things stand.

S-Tier

Happy Chaos continues to dominate the top of the list. His unique gun mechanic makes neutral completely different against him, and the Season 4 buff to his reload speed removed one of the few windows opponents had to close the gap.

Nago is a damage machine. Season 4 didn't touch him, and that means the rest of the cast is still trying to deal with Blood stacks, impossible-to-punish normals, and a throw game that leads to full combos.

Asuka — his spells were buffed in a way that makes his neutral footsies even stronger. If you don't have a fast, safe way to close distance, you're going to struggle here.

A-Tier

  • Ky Kiske — well-rounded and benefited from the RC recovery change; more forgiving to use now
  • Sol — unchanged, still a solid foundation character; slightly pressured by the new arrivals
  • Bridget — yo-yo pressure remains oppressive; slightly less explosive damage than S-tier
  • Leo — strong in the corner, weaker than before in open neutral

B-Tier

  • Ram — good buttons but her backdash got nerfed; loses some of her defensive neutral options
  • Goldlewis — tanky, high damage, requires excellent reads; very matchup-dependent
  • Faust — gimmick-heavy; effective at lower levels, increasingly readable at high level

C-Tier

  • Anji — reflect still useful in specific matchups, but his low damage output limits his ceiling
  • Zato — Eddie management is rewarding but expensive to learn; limited reward at average execution levels

The Big Picture

Season 4 tightened the spread between B and S-tier compared to previous seasons. You can realistically take any A-tier character to Celestial with solid fundamentals. S-tier is where you go if you want to take shortcuts.
